A PARK is to undergo a £104,000 facelift.

Craghead Community Park, near Stanley, is to get a £50,000 ball court with goalposts, basketball hoops and cricket stumps.

Plans are also under way to install a £30,000 toddlers' play park and carry out access and environmental improvements.

Community organisation the Craghead Development Trust will be working with environmental charity Groundwork West Durham, Barclays and the Football Foundation to provide the multi-use games area.

The project will work to ensure long-term activities are available and provide coaching kit and equipment to encourage residents to make the most of the facilities.

Project manager Kath Ivens, of Groundwork, said: "Our experience shows that people really value the opportunity to have a say in improving their neighbourhoods and make them better places to live, work and play. Getting involved in these projects gives people confidence and makes us all feel proud of where we live."

The scheme is being funded with cash from the European Regional Development Fund and Barclays Spaces for Sports, a community sponsorship programme to create and improve sports facilities.
